Kia Sorento Competitors: A Detailed Comparison
The mid-size SUV segment offers a wide range of options. Let’s see how the Kia Sorento measures up against its key rivals:
Performance and Fuel Efficiency
- Volkswagen Tiguan: While offering a comfortable ride, the Tiguan’s engine options and fuel economy often fall short of the Sorento’s more diverse and efficient powertrains.
- Ford Explorer: The Explorer emphasizes power and towing capacity. However, the Sorento often provides a more balanced combination of performance and fuel efficiency, making it a compelling alternative for daily driving.
- Hyundai Santa Fe: The Santa Fe delivers a smooth ride, but the Sorento typically boasts a more engaging driving experience with quicker acceleration.
- Lexus RX: Known for its luxury and smooth ride, the RX often comes with a higher price tag. The Sorento offers a compelling blend of performance and value.
- Nissan Murano: The Murano prioritizes style and comfort. The Sorento, however, often presents a more dynamic driving experience with a wider range of engine choices.
- Honda Pilot: Favored for reliability and space, the Pilot may not match the Sorento’s agility and fuel economy.
- Nissan Pathfinder: Similar to the Pilot, the Pathfinder focuses on comfort and space but might lack the Sorento’s refined driving dynamics.
- Subaru Ascent: With standard all-wheel drive, the Ascent caters to families needing enhanced traction. The Sorento offers comparable capabilities with potentially better fuel efficiency.
- Toyota Highlander: The Highlander is known for reliability and resale value. The Sorento challenges it with a compelling combination of performance, features, and a competitive price.
